Wide application range

Versatility is the main advantage of air operated double diaphragm pumps, as they are capable of pumping numerous fluids. These vary from shear sensitive fluids to slurries as well as abrasive/corrosive fluids and, by choosing the right design and the right materials, they can fulfill the installation requirements without causing problems for the pump or final product. Another important aspect is the fluid does not necessarily must be clean, it may contain suspended solids, causing them to be well suited for the most unfortunate applications and working conditions.

Given their versatility, they can be seen in many industries. They may be utilized for transferring acids from the chemical industry or for slip transfer within the ceramic industry. This demonstrates the pumps great deal of use and exactly how they're able to accommodate any application. The most frequent uses are tank loading/unloading, fluid batching/mixing, recirculation and transfer, water extraction and treatment, coating and mold filling. More performance benefits

In addition to their versatility, these pumps give a group of competitive advantages compared to other technologies, in terms of performance features and price reduction.

These pumps are capable of running dry without damaging the pump and they also tend not to increase heat during operation. Furthermore, they're self-priming and ideal for suction lift applications. They may be safer than other pumps, since they don't have got electrical hazards, they may be found in explosive atmospheres (ATEX certified models) and will operate completely submerged without diminishing their performance.

Along with their performance, they are an inexpensive option for many applications in comparison with other pump technologies because of their ease of operation and maintenance.

AODD pumps start automatically once the fluid outlet is opened so that it is easy and simple to integrate in a pumping system. Also, the fluid discharge pressure and flow rate are often adjustable by utilizing just one air pressure regulator. The possible lack of mechanical and dynamic seals makes service faster and easier, thus minimizing the cost and time forced to restore the pump.
